I can’t believe it took me so long to discover L’eclair. This Japanese/French pastry shop creates excellent pastries that have that light, not too sweet or too heavy feeling that you look for in Japanese versions of French patisserie. The namesake eclair is ace: the choux pastry has great texture and the filling is just right. All of the cakes I’ve tried have been great: I personally really like the Mont Blanc and the filled choux pastries. I was also really impressed with the strawberry sponge: one time one of my friends got it and was worried he had made the “wrong” and “boring” choice… he was very happy to be proven very wrong. Small quaint cafe with beautiful pastries on display. The food was delicious and well presented, the flavours and textures took me straight to Japan. I ordered the udon omelette which was tasty and flavours were well balanced with ginger, smoky katsuoboshi, mayonnaise, okonomiyaki sauce and soy coated udon. Next I ordered the Green Tea roll which was amazing! The cake sponge was moist and soft, the cream light and the flavours of green tea, cream, egg were delectable.
